DEPARTMENT OF AGRICULTURE Forest Service Reinstatement of Information Collection; Pesticide-Use Proposal AGENCY: Forest Service, USDA. ACTION: Notice; request for comment. SUMMARY: In accordance with the Paperwork Reduction Act of 1995, the Forest Service is seeking comments from all interested individuals and organizations on the reinstatement of a previously approved information collection, Pesticide-Use Proposal. DATES: Comments must be received in writing on or before July 20, 2026 to be assured of consideration. Comments received after that date will be considered to the extent practicable. OMB Number: 0596-0241. Expiration Date of Approval: N/A. Type of Request: Reinstatement of a previously approved information collection. Abstract: The Forest Service (FS or Agency) has Federal land stewardship responsibilities for approximately 193 million acres of grasslands and forests (National Forest System land). These land management responsibilities require use of integrated pest management, which in certain circumstances includes use of pesticides. The FS currently uses form FS-2100-2, Pesticide-Use Proposal (PUP), internally to collect and review pesticide applications intended to control pests on National Forest System land (under FSM 2150, and FSH 2109.14). The FS anticipates requests from outside entities for application of pesticides upon National Forest System land within rights-of-way easements, permitted lands, and under similar circumstances. The FS proposes to use the PUP form to collect pesticide project information from those outside entities to facilitate authorization of selected activities. Completion of the PUP form includes identification of pests to be controlled, pesticide to be applied, and other regulatory compliance information such as use of certified applicators. Because diverse pesticide-use projects are designed for local conditions, it is appropriate for the PUP form to be used to ensure that essential details are uniformly assembled for review. Proposals will be evaluated by FS pesticide use coordinators and other administrative personnel to safeguard human health and ecological protection consistent with FS land use management programs. Form and instructions will be posted on a FS website for ready public availability. Affected Public: Individuals and Households, Businesses and Organizations, and State, Local or Tribal Governments responsible for pest control, including vegetation management along rights-of-way, upon National Forest System land. Estimate of Burden per Response: 12 hours. Estimated Annual Number of Respondents: 36. Estimated Annual Number of Responses: 50. Estimated Total Annual Burden on Respondents: 600 hours.
